Select Brand:

Show All


£7.64

Dispatch on next business day

£4.12

Dispatch on next business day

£6.49

Dispatch on next business day

£9.28

Dispatch on next business day

£6.03

Dispatch on next business day

£7.85

Dispatch on next business day

£8.94

Dispatch on next business day

£12.65

Dispatch on next business day

£17.20

Dispatch on next business day

£5.95

Dispatch on next business day

£3.40

Dispatch on next business day

£1.88

Dispatch on next business day